Basic Internet infrastructure has been erratic for a couple of weeks with an AWS outage and now a Microsoft outage. Both are very large hosting companies for companies like GF who do not run their own servers (or potentially your ISP as well). I don’t recall which GF uses for their servers but they’re undoubtedly affected. The route to their servers may also be impacted depending on your ISP (Microsoft is reporting DNS issues - the “how do I get there?” service that tells your browser how to find things).
